Dylan Darling's Buzzer-Beater Sends St. John's to NCAA Sweet 16 Over Kansas

St. John's, coached by Rick Pitino, advanced to the Sweet 16 of the NCAA men's basketball tournament for the first time since 1999 after a dramatic 67-65 win over Kansas. Despite a quiet game, Dylan "Bells" Darling scored a buzzer-beating layup to secure the victory. Pitino expressed strong trust in Darling, who contributed with assists and steals. Kansas tied the game late, but St. John's executed a final play that led to the winning shot.
